L'AFRACA participe à l'étude de marché FinRegLab et CIS Kenya sur le renforcement de l'utilisation de données alternatives pour avoir un impact sur l'inclusion financiÚre, la concurrence sur le marché et la protection des consommateurs au Kenya.

The Market Insight study was based on wide consultations with industry stakeholders over a five-month period. The study centered on the Kenya credit ecosystem and the implications of using alternative data (non-traditional) to prudently extend credit access to micro and small enterprises (MSE’s) in Kenya. The study acknowledges the availability of pockets of alternative data (not-traditional) available in different forms and structure such as data from payment service providers, transactional data from supermarkets, utility firms etc, supply chain data among others....

Technologies intégrées et circulaires pour les systÚmes alimentaires urbains durables en Afrique (INCiTiS) - Le projet FOOD démarre à Nairobi.

The INCiTiS-FOOD project is co-funded by the European Union’s Horizon Europe research and innovation programme. The project brings together 24 partners across 14 countries in Europe and Africa mainly from Academia. INCiTiS-FOOD aims to improve food and nutrition security in African city regions, develop sustainable food systems and reduce the environmental footprint. To achieve these goals, the project will identify best- fit agri-food technologies, practices, and novel business models focused on soilless crop farming, recirculating aquaculture systems, and insect farming.
